LuLu’s Mall Millionaire campaign gets under way

LuLu Group International has launched the second edition of its Mall Millionaire campaign at nine of its malls in Abu Dhabi and Al Ain after a two-year hiatus amid the Covid-19 pandemic.  

The campaign is running at Abu Dhabi’s Al Wahda Mall, Mushrif Mall, Khalidiya Mall, Al Raha Mall, Mazyad Mall, Madinat Zayed Shopping Centre, Forsan Central Mall and Al Ain’s Barari Outlet Mall and Al Foah Mall from April 23 to August 6. 

Shoppers who spend AED200 in select malls can enter a raffle draw to win a mega prize of AED1 million on August 10.  

“Shoppers can accumulate too, which means they can shop at different outlets in a mall and the total bill adds to AED200,” said Navaneeth Sudhakaran, general manager of Al Wahda Mall.  

“They can even combine bills of different days inside this campaign period, but they must shop at the same mall. Bills from different malls cannot be combined,” Mr Sudhakaran said.  

Malls are also holding 14 weekly raffle draws where shoppers can win between AED25,000 and AED350,000.  

During the final week of the campaign, shoppers can win gift coupons worth AED150,000 by participating in various games and events.   

The campaign is operated by Line Investments and Property, the LuLu Group International’s shopping centre development and management division.  

“This is a much bigger and better format compared to the first season,” said Wajeb Khoury, director of Line Investments and Property.  

“Our goal this year is to support the post-pandemic recovery of the economy and social activities while following all the safety protocols set by the authorities,” Mr Khoury said.  

The campaign is a partnership between LuLu Group International and Retail Abu Dhabi, the retail division of Abu Dhabi’s Department of Culture and Tourism.
